Rain and wet conditions led to the accident. Equipment and equipment ladder was in good working order, operator had on EE's PPE, and three points of contact was being implemented. Operator suffered a closed displaced fracture of shaft of fourth metacarpal bone of left hand. Operator's foot slipped on ladder rung causing EE to slip and hand got caught on the ladder.

Showing all 3Quarry personnel were performing a steel change, concave for cone crusher. New concave placed on blocks of wood at the crusher before using the crane to place in crusher. A block of wood got knocked out and a miner's foot was underneath when it tipped and trapped right foot. The weight of the concave broke big toe.
Customer driving a 4 axle dump truck could not get tailgate closed after being loaded with gravel. Driver used hand instead of a hand-held tool to free a rock that was preventing latch from closing. Upon removal of the rock the latch closed on the driver's hand removing skin from the area between pointer finger and thumb.
